On Fri, 09 Jun 2000 19:08:56 -0400 Richard Waters
writes:
> I would like to see a review of cheap toilet paper to use. Don't
> think this is too stupid. It is something that most of use in our
> coaches.
>

No need for a poll...............take a sheet of paper from different
sources, put one in a jar of water and shake it up.

The one that disolves is the one you want to use.

I have find single ply is less likely to cause problems!
